The Award for Excellence

Counties Serving Disabled Americans

Applications for the 1996 Award for Excellence Program, which honors counties serving disabled Americans, are now available from NACo’s Research Department. Deadline for submission is April 15.

The three-year-old program is sponsored by NACo and the National Organization on Disabilities, in conjunction with the J.C. Penney Co. The $1,000 cash award is given to a NACo member county with the most outstanding program or project targeted at improving the quality of life for disabled Americans.

Programs will be judged on their measured success, ability to be replicated in other communities, innovation, leadership, and community involvement. A panel of five judges, appointed by NACo, will evaluate all applications accordingly. The selection will be made by June 1, 1996 and the award will be presented at the 1996 NACo Annual Conference in Harris County (Houston, Texas).
